However, more and more businesses are takingFeb 8, 2021 · Each of the types of stakeholders in a business are categorized in 3 ways: Internal or external. Primary or secondary. Direct or indirect. Internal stakeholders are, as the name suggests, stakeholders that exist inside a business. These are stakeholders who are directly affected by a project, such as employees.

Internally, stakeholders include employees, project teams, managers, the board of directors and shareholders. Primary stakeholders are individuals that have a direct influence on and are directly impacted by the performance of the company.
